Course Outline
Achieving DevSecOps Sovereignty with GitLab
- Comparison of features and control levels across GitLab CE, EE, and GitLab.com.
- Omnibus architecture and Kubernetes Helm deployment options.
- Risks of SaaS lock-in and data residency requirements.
Installation and Architecture
- Omnibus installation on Ubuntu with PostgreSQL and Redis.
- GitLab Helm chart deployment on Kubernetes with persistent volumes.
- Configuration of external services: object storage, SMTP, and LDAP.
- Geo replication for multi-region disaster recovery.
Repository and Project Management
- Structure of groups, subgroups, and project hierarchies.
- Merge request workflows, code review processes, and approval rules.
- Agile planning using issue boards, epics, and milestones.
- Utilizing wikis, snippets, and release management.
CI/CD Pipeline Engineering
- Understanding .gitlab-ci.yml syntax, stages, and job dependencies.
- Types of runners: shared, group, and specific.
- Docker executor, Kubernetes executor, and autoscaling capabilities.
- Artifact caching, registry publishing, and deployment stages.
Security Scanning
- SAST, DAST, dependency scanning, and container scanning.
- Secret detection and license compliance.
- Vulnerability dashboards and remediation tracking.
Authentication and Authorization
- LDAP, SAML, and OpenID Connect SSO integration.
- Two-factor authentication and personal access tokens.
- IP allowlisting and audit event logging.
Registry and Package Management
- Container registry: authentication, cleanup policies, and replication.
- Package registry support for Maven, npm, PyPI, and Conan.
- Generic package uploads for internal artifacts.
Monitoring and Scaling
- GitLab Exporter metrics and Grafana dashboards.
- Database tuning and PgBouncer connection pooling.
- Horizontal scaling of web, API, and sidekiq nodes.
- Backup strategies: rake tasks, object storage, and restore verification.
